OneCall24 Healthcare Limited is seeking a compassionate Healthcare Support Worker for complex care in Staffordshire. This role involves delivering high-quality support in clients' homes, ensuring their wellbeing and comfort.
Responsibilities include:
- Monitoring conditions
- Assisting with daily activities
The position offers competitive pay starting at £15.00, guaranteed hours, and set rotas, making it a rewarding opportunity to make a significant impact in clients' lives.

How to prepare for a job interview at OneCall24 Healthcare Limited
✨Know Your Stuff
Before the interview, make sure you understand the role of a Healthcare Support Worker. Familiarise yourself with the responsibilities like monitoring conditions and assisting with daily activities. This will help you answer questions confidently and show that you're genuinely interested in the position.
✨Show Your Compassion
Since this role is all about delivering high-quality support, be prepared to share examples of how you've shown compassion in previous roles. Think of specific situations where you made a difference in someone's life, as this will resonate well with the interviewers.
✨Ask Thoughtful Questions
Interviews are a two-way street! Prepare some thoughtful questions about the company culture, team dynamics, or how they measure success in this role. This shows that you're not just looking for any job, but that you're genuinely interested in being part of their team.
✨Dress for Success
Even though the role is in healthcare, first impressions matter. Dress smartly and professionally for your interview. It shows respect for the opportunity and indicates that you take the role seriously, which can set you apart from other candidates.
